This commit fixes an issue in the `entrypoint.sh` script where the directory was not being changed back to its original location after running the model download script for Krita. The `cd ..` command has been replaced with `cd -`, which correctly returns to the previous working directory, ensuring that subsequent commands in the script are executed from the expected path. This change prevents potential errors and ensures the script behaves as intended.
This commit refactors the `entrypoint.sh` script to enhance error handling and ensure consistent use of quotes around variables. Specifically:
1. **Error Handling**: Added `set +e` before `git pull` commands within the loop for updating custom nodes, allowing the script to continue processing other nodes even if one fails. This is followed by `set -e` to revert to strict error handling.
2. **Consistent Quoting**: Ensured that all variables are quoted consistently throughout the script to prevent issues with spaces or special characters in file paths.
3. **Command Placement**: Moved the model download command for Krita after checking and creating symbolic links, ensuring that models are downloaded into the correct directory structure.
4. **Use of `cp -a` Instead of `mv`**: Changed the use of `mv` to `cp -a` when copying custom nodes to preserve file attributes and avoid accidental deletion of source files.
These changes improve the robustness and reliability of the script, making it more resilient to errors and ensuring that all operations are performed correctly.

Fix the problem that some extensions need to be installed from src
Now, because the step of installing extensions is moved forward in
`entrypoint.sh` instead of `startup.sh`, we cannot install some required
packages before executing `install.py`
When installing the extension `sd-webui-roop`, it relies on
`insightface==0.7.3`, and when installing this pypi package, it is found
that when building the wheel package, an error will be reported because
`gcc` cannot be found
ddc02ee1a9/requirements.txt (L1)
Therefore, considering that not all pypi packages are distributed in
wheel, those pypi packages distributed in src need `build-essential` to
build
Perform a full extension installation process instead of just installing
dependencies
Some extensions do not include `requirements.txt` but install
dependencies in `install.py`, and all extensions include `install.py`,
so it is safe to use it for extended dependency installation
This is because the extension development of AUTOMATIC1111's webui does
not require the existence of `requirements.txt` but uses `install.py` to
initialize the extension
https://github.com/AUTOMATIC1111/stable-diffusion-webui/wiki/Developing-extensions#installpy

`jq` merge direction in this case is right to left so if the user had
set up custom paths it would replace them with the default ones.
This PR switches the direction to use the defaults as fallback instead
of overwriting user settings.

## Justification
Closes issue #352
This update makes the Dockerfiles OCI compliant, making it easier to use
Buildah or other image building techniques that require it
## Implementation
This changes a few things, listed below:
* auto: Download container is switched to alpine. The `git` container
specified the `/git` directory as a volume. As such, all the files under
`/git` would be lost after each script invoke. Alpine is used later in
the build process anyway, so it shouldn't be any extra cost to switch to
it
* auto: "New" clone.sh script is copied into the container, which is
basically just the previous clone script that was embedded in the
Dockerfile.
* all: `<<EOF` heredoc styles have been switched to `&& \`
* all: I added NVIDIA_DRIVER_CAPABILITIES and NVIDIA_VISIBLE_DEVICES to
expose my Nvidia card. This is most likely a selinux/podman problem, but
shouldn't change anything with docker to add it.
* docker-compose: I added selinux labeling. I tested this with real
docker (not just podman!) and it seems to work fine. Though I suggest
you try it too.
## Testing
Locally builds with buildah.
Note: for caching to work properly, you still need to replace
`/root/.cache/pip` with `/root/.cache/pip,Z` on selinux systems.

Upon enabling the ControlNet addon from
https://github.com/AbdBarho/stable-diffusion-webui-docker/pull/385 one
might want to use the `openpose` preprocessors. Those are downloaded by
the addon the first time they are used. Without proper mounts those
networks will be downloaded on usage after each container start.
This PR enables those mounts to reduce data traffic.
The ControlNet addon
[sd-webui-controlnet](https://github.com/Mikubill/sd-webui-controlnet)
requires the `data/ControlNet` folder to be mounted into
`models/ControlNet`.
This PR enables said mount and adds the ControlNet folder to
`.gitignore` file.

Docker compose allows override some settings in `docker-compose.yml` by
using additional file: `docker-compose.override.yml`.
This allows to hold own settings in override file which does not
conflict with updates made by pulling newer version with "git pull"
command.
This feature requires three things:
1. Creating `docker-compose.override.yml-dist` file which is a
distributed file inside repo. This file can be copied as
`docker-compose.override.yml` and modified for own needs.
2. Change in `.gitignore` file so `docker-compose.override.yml` file is
ignored, so git pull / commit will not complain about this file.
3. Modify wiki entry about setup to mention possibility to use this
method.

Run Stable Diffusion on your machine with a nice UI without any hassle!
This repository provides the [WebUI](https://github.com/hlky/stable-diffusion-webui) as docker for easy setup and deployment. Please note that this repo delivers all cutting-edge unstable changes from the WebUI, so expect some bugs.
## Setup
make sure you have docker installed and up to date. Download this repo and run:
```
docker compose build
```
you can let it build in the background while you download the different models
- [Stable Diffusion v1.4 (4GB)](https://drive.yerf.org/wl/?id=EBfTrmcCCUAGaQBXVIj5lJmEhjoP1tgl), rename to `model.ckpt`
- (Optional) [GFPGANv1.3.pth (333MB)](https://github.com/TencentARC/GFPGAN/releases/download/v1.3.0/GFPGANv1.3.pth) to improve generated faces.
- (Optional) [RealESRGAN_x4plus.pth (64MB)](https://github.com/xinntao/Real-ESRGAN/releases/download/v0.1.0/RealESRGAN_x4plus.pth) and [RealESRGAN_x4plus_anime_6B.pth (18MB)](https://github.com/xinntao/Real-ESRGAN/releases/download/v0.2.2.4/RealESRGAN_x4plus_anime_6B.pth) for super-sampling.
Put all of the downloaded models in the `models` folder, the folder structure should look something like this:
```
├── README.md
├── docker-compose.yml
├── build
├── cache
├── models
│ ├── GFPGANv1.3.pth
│ ├── RealESRGAN_x4plus.pth
│ ├── RealESRGAN_x4plus_anime_6B.pth
│ └── model.ckpt
├── output
```
## Run
After the build is done, you can run the app with:
```
docker compose up --build
```
Will start the app on http://localhost:7860/
Note: the first start will take sometime as some other models will be downloaded, these will be cached in the `cache` folder, so next runs are faster.
## Config
in the `docker-compose.yml` you can change the `CLI_ARGS` variable contains all of the variables that will be passed to [the web ui](https://github.com/hlky/stable-diffusion-webui/blob/49e6178fd82ca736f9bbc621c6b12487c300e493/webui.py), by default: `--extra-models-cpu --optimized-turbo` are given, which allow you to use this model on a 6GB GPU.
